Lightning kills 2 boys

Last Updated 25 May 2011, 18:21 IST

Mallaiah (14) was killed when lightning struck his house in Balichakra village of Yadgir taluk. Tayamma (4), Santoshamma (6), Malavva (48) and Bheemappa (58) sustained injuries in the incident, police said. The injured have been admitted to the district hospital.

Narasappa (16) of Mansalapur in Raichur taluk was killed by lightning while he was returning home. According to police, Narasappa was walking to his village when the incident occurred. Cloudy weather accompanied with high velocity winds and heavy lightning prevailed during the evening in Yadgir and Raichur. However, there was no sign of rain.

Heavy rain

Rain lashed Mysore, Chamarajanagar and Mandya districts on Wednesday morning. The downpour lasted for about two hours in Mysore. Rain water gushed into houses in low-lying areas  in Halahalli of Mandya. The Hanuman Temple near Banaghatta in Pandavapura taluk was inundated.

Normal life was thrown out of gear in Chamarjanagar district due to heavy rain on Tuesday night and Wednesday morning. There have been no reports of loss of life and damage to property. Mandya taluk recorded 24.9 mm of rainfall while it was 45.7 mm in Chamarajanagar taluk.
